Sino-Italian Cooperation Boosts Green Olympics:
Fruitful Environmental Cooperation between IMET and Beijing Municipality

On December 6, 2004, a new Memo of Understanding (MOU) was signed between Italian Ministry for the Environment and Territory (IMET) and Beijing Municipality, putting forward four additional environmental cooperation projects. Up to present, the cooperation projects between IMET and Beijing Municipality have reached a total number of 13. Among the fruitful projects, the project IVECO NEF CNG Engines on Beijing Public Transport Corporation (BPTC) Autobus has been advancing most substantially. By the end of December 2004, all of the 300 sets of gas powered IVECO engines had been equipped to the city buses of Beijing. While other projects are well in the progress of implementation, tendering, planning or preliminary preparation.

Gap between Green Olympics Benchmark and Environmental Situation in Beijing

In 2004, the number of days when air quality is up to and above level two in downtown districts reached 229, two days exceeding the fixed target 227. The Blue Sky Mission in 2004 was successfully accomplished. The annual average daily SO2 concentrations, for the first time since 20 years, reached the national standard. Compared with 1998, the number of days above weather benchmark level increased from 100 to 229, having improved by 35.2%, whereas the number of days when pollution is medium and serious decreased from 141 to 17. The concentrations of key atmospheric pollutants decreased significantly. SO2 decreased by 54%, NO2 by 4% and inhalable particles by 17%.

However, the existing environmental protection situation in Beijing is not yet rosy. The gross pollutants emission has exceeded the environmental capacity. One of the most challenging environmental problems is the excessive atmospheric particle concentrations. According to sources with environmental authorities, the annual average concentration of inhalable particles in downtown districts is 141 mg/m3, exceeding national standard by 41%. To resolve particle pollution has become the key to improve the air quality in Beijing. Presently, the atmospheric pollution in Beijing has developed into a complex situation. The booming construction covers a total area of 100 million square meters, where more than 6,000 sites are distributed over the city. The annual coal consumption exceeds 26 million tons. The number of motor vehicles has come up to 2 million. However, the dropout of cars below emission standard is still in slow progress. Compared with other international cities such as Tokyo and London, the atmospheric pollution control of Beijing poses a greater challenge.
